Pinto Beans In Farberware Pressure Cooker. yes, you can cook a variety of beans in a farberware electric pressure cooker, including black beans, kidney beans, pinto beans, chickpeas, and more. The pressure cooker is versatile and can handle different types of beans with ease. fast, creamy, thick, hearty, smoky and delicious!
